About The Position

The position provides support to end-user requests for technical assistance by phone, email, or ticketing system. Troubleshoots and resolves basic computer, application, system, device, access, or performance issues. Uses established processes and procedures to document, track, and resolve reported problems and to meet operational service levels and standards. Utilizes product information or solution database to research, troubleshoot, and deliver solutions. Advises users on the methods, steps, and actions to resolve and avoid future issues and provides documentation as needed. Escalates problems to appropriate levels or teams to achieve issue resolution. May support installs or upgrades of software or devices, set up user profiles, or re-set passwords. Fulfills all service level standards for response time and quality. Works under moderate supervision. Gaining or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line.

Responsibilities

  • Perform remote and hands-on fixes, including installing and upgrading software, installing hardware, and configuring systems and applications.
  • Support for all IT peripheral equipment e.g. Telephony, Printers, Meeting room equipment, etc.
  • Basic Active Directory administration: Amend group permissions and reset network and applications passwords.
  • Create and evaluate documented resolutions and analyse trends for ways to prevent future problems.
  • Alert management to emerging trends in incidents.
  • Assist in the deployment of new hardware and ensure that changes are tracked, and inventory is updated.
